    “Social networking is still a luxury, and I don’t have time to use it for my business.” Does this sound familiar? This is the most common excuse I receive from entrepreneurs and clients. So, since we all have the same amount of hours in a day, how does Dawn Papandrea-Khan, a mompreneur of four kids under the age of six manage to run three businesses and make time to use social networking to grow her business?

    I met Dawn on Twitter last year and hired her for a few graphic design projects. Not only was I tremendously impressed by her work, but also by her dedication to make social networking work for her business. A couple of months ago, Dawn mentioned to me that 90 percent of her clients come from Twitter. So, I invited Dawn to share her story with my blog readers.

    Let’s listen to what she has to say in this 20-minute interview:
